The Dead Sea is the most salty body of water in the entire world and is also the lowest point on earth. It has a salt content of 33%.
Many visitors to the Dead Sea enjoy the unusual buoyancy that one can experience. I did not swim in the Dead Sea but I did take a few stones, put my hand in the water, take pictures of fellow travelers, and enjoy the beautiful rainbow that broke through the clouds that day.
